Alcohol Weight

When it comes to alcohol; it is hard to avoid having a glass of wine, a holiday martini or champagne.

First and foremost, alcohol is loaded with calories and sugar. Many of us don’t recognize the amount of calories in one drink. In addition, alcohol can lower your inhibitions. Hence, you may be visiting the bar area often.

Events during the Holidays and Winter Months

When you attend an event; there is usually a lot of appetizers and food set up. See if there is a vegetable platter. Munch on a carrot and hold a glass of water. By having your hands filled; you are avoiding calories of other food.

If you are having an alcoholic beverage; I recommend taking small sips of your drink. Also, try to make a note to not hang around the food too much.

If you are around a huge buffet, try to stick to healthier options. However, if that isn’t an option; you can always have smaller portions.

Finally, if you are the host of an upcoming holiday party or game day party in the winter months; serve healthier snacks.
